Subject: [PATCH 1/2] x86/xen: don't indicate DCA support in pv domains
Date: Fri, 17 Feb 2017 08:36:24 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20170217073625.13418-2-jgross@suse.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20170217073625.13418-1-jgross@suse.com>

Xen doesn't support DCA (direct cache access) for pv domains. Clear
the corresponding capability indicator.

Signed-off-by: Juergen Gross <jgross@suse.com>
---
 arch/x86/xen/enlighten.c | 3 +++
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+)

diff --git a/arch/x86/xen/enlighten.c b/arch/x86/xen/enlighten.c
index 51ef952..83399ce 100644
--- a/arch/x86/xen/enlighten.c
+++ b/arch/x86/xen/enlighten.c
@@ -461,6 +461,9 @@ static void __init xen_init_cpuid_mask(void)
 		cpuid_leaf1_ecx_mask &= ~xsave_mask; /* disable XSAVE & OSXSAVE */
 	if (xen_check_mwait())
 		cpuid_leaf1_ecx_set_mask = (1 << (X86_FEATURE_MWAIT % 32));
+
+	/* Disable DCA feature. */
+	setup_clear_cpu_cap(X86_FEATURE_DCA);
 }
